STEVE McMANAMAN confirmed the worst fears of his Liverpool employers last night by admitting that he has signed a transfer agreement with Real Madrid which will earn him around ý14 million over the next five years.

Liverpool, having groomed McManaman from raw schoolboy to international stardom, will get nothing for their efforts except the bitter realisation that they are the latest victims of the freedom of contract rulings which resulted from legal action instigated by the moderate Belgian footballer Jean-Marc Bosman.

McManaman's departure from Merseyside is no surprise. He had been threatening to leave when his contract expires next summer but Liverpool, having secured the services of his closest friend, Robbie Fowler, for a further three years only five days ago, were hopeful that the England winger could be persuaded to stay.

The opportunity to join one of the world's most famous clubs and guarantee financial security for life understandably proved irresistible to McManaman, who will be 27 in two weeks' time. "I'm really looking forward to it," he enthused.

"I'm extremely sad to be leaving Liverpool," he said. "It was such a tough decision because I've been here 12 years but I've always stated that I wanted to play in Europe at some stage. Now is the right time. This is a chance to test myself in a top European league.

"I chose Real Madrid above the other top European clubs that came in for me because I've always thought they were an excellent club," he said, warning that the deal has not yet been concluded. He still needs to pass a medical test, which probably will take place on Monday.

Due to move on July 1 for a salary of about ý50,000 a week, he added: "I'm ambitious to win things as a player and the fact that they were European champions last year was a persuasive factor because I knew I was joining a really good club. Although I've been to Spain loads of times I've never visited the club, but a lot of people spoke very highly of the set-up there to me."
